Repair of residential windows
A damaged window isn't only an eyesore but can also cause leaks and drafts that can add to your energy bills. Window repair companies can restore windows to their original condition, regardless of whether you have one or more cracked panes of glass. Some repair firms will provide upgrades, like installing energy-efficient glass options that can cut your heating and cooling costs significantly.
The cost of window repair is contingent on the type and extent of damage and Emergency Glaziers the frame material as well as labor. The cost for a single crack in a single-paned window is about $70. However replacing a damaged wooden frame or a broken seal between the panes could be up to $500. Some window repairs for home use can be done on site however some may require that the technician transport the damaged window glaziers near me to their workshop.
Oftentimes, minor cracks in frames or glass are easily fixed by using a simple epoxy. If your window is double-paned but only one pane has cracked professional repair can use an organic compound to fill in the crack and make the glass look as good as new. If your window's latches and hinges are damaged, a repair firm can replace them which will make it easier to open.
In some instances windows may need to be removed entirely to make more extensive repairs. It is important to act swiftly in the event that the frame has begun to rot. Some rotting areas can be fixed with epoxy, but others may require replacement with a new window.
Many homeowners are hesitant to invest in window repairs especially if the damage or windows are old. However, repairing or replacing a window can save you money in the long run by reducing the cost of energy and preventing mold growth. Commercial Window Repair
Commercial windows are usually found in office buildings, large industrial structures and high-rises. They can be larger than windows for residential use and require specialized care and maintenance. These windows are more difficult to reach, and require ladders and other equipment. Commercial window repair and replacement services are offered for these structures, Glazing Repairs Near Me and they are designed to address issues with chips, cracks, seals and leaks.
In contrast to windows for residential homes, which are mostly supported by wooden frames, storefront windows are typically framed in aluminum or vinyl. These materials are less prone to insect infestation and rot than wood, and can be painted or powder coated to match the building's color scheme. However, they are still susceptible to damage caused by weather conditions and other environmental elements. This is why it is essential for these companies to employ a skilled team that is specialized in commercial window repair.
Even the best quality glazed glass will eventually degrade and require replacement. There are a variety of reasons for this, ranging from vandalism to accidents to wear and tear that is caused by use and age. Commercial building owners also have to watch their energy bills each month because the high cost could be due to poorly insulated glass windows.
While it is acceptable to repair minor damages, like a stuck window caulking, sealant and caulking issues minor scratches and issues with tint and glaze coatings, it is important for businesses to maintain a regular maintenance schedule that includes professional inspections. These inspections will allow you to spot problems before they turn into serious issues. The inspections could also include surface-level clean-up and testing for water, air and heat infiltration, as well as safety and compliance checks with code enforcement.
One method to prevent irreparable damage and extend the life of commercial windows is installing security film. This simple fix can strengthen windows and makes them more resistant to burglaries and other threats. It also ensures clear views and lowers energy costs. Historic Window Restoration
Many older buildings have historic windows that are part of the overall style and beauty of a structure. Unfortunately, these windows are often neglected and are discarded in preference to replacement windows. While replacing windows could be a good option in certain situations, it's important to remember that the windows constructed in the past were made from woods that are exceptionally durable and old growth. These windows aren't just longer-lasting and more stable than modern replacements, they can also be improved in energy efficiency with simple changes.
A restored and well-maintained historic window can add character and beauty to any business or home. Window restoration is a procedure that requires the careful removal of the window, repair or replacement of damaged parts, and reassembling using traditional methods and materials. This is a labor-intensive and lengthy process, but worth it.
Historic window restorations can be done on one window or an entire building. Typically, these windows are in good condition and require only a few repairs to return them to their original condition. Before you begin any work on your windows, it's best to consult an expert. They can help you decide on the work to be done as well as the cost.
One of the most common issues with windows that are old is that the sash will not close properly. Most often, this is due to the hinges being too loose. Sometimes, a tiny piece behind the hinge could alter the way the sash is placed in the frame.
Other issues that are common are water infiltration, cracked glass and missing muntins. They can all be fixed or replaced with similar products to restore the quality of the window. In certain instances glass can be reglazed using the most accurate and historically accurate glazing repairs beads. Remember that these windows may be over 100 years old and have been in use for decades. They will need maintenance at some point.
